Red Devils win four as part of hot start to volleyball season

ERIE — Off to a blazing hot start to the fall campaign, the Erie Red Devils went 4-0 in a pair of volleyball triangulars to begin a busy week.

Erie hosted Caney Valley and Cherryvale on Monday, beating both.

The Red Devils needed three sets to down Caney Valley, 2-1 (15-25, 25-13, 25-22). Erie then took down Cherryvale, 2-1 (25-22, 21-25, 25-21).

Stats were unavailable for Erie’s home matches on Monday.

Heading to St. Paul on Tuesday, the Red Devils took down Pleasanton, 2-0 (25-16, 25-19).

Lila Michael, a junior, led Erie with eight kills on 15 attempts. Erie’s offense mounted a .543 kill percentage.

Lillee Fawel and Kylie Hodgden each paced Erie with four digs while Kaeleigh Daniels amassed 14 assists in the win over Pleasanton.

Erie then took down St. Paul, 2-1 (24-26, 25-13, 25-23).

Hodgden elevated for 12 kills for the Red Devils. Michael tallied six blocks while Andi Nordt added four.

Gawell had 16 digs while Daniels added 10 to go along with a dozen assists.

Up next

Erie, now 7-2 on the young season, has another home triangular on Sept. 8.
